Bulk bag sewing machineThe material of lock stitch sewing machine needles is another factor to consider. Most needles are made from high-quality steel, often coated with chrome or nickel to enhance durability and reduce friction. These coatings enable smoother sewing, especially when working with dense or heavy materials. Using the right needle material can significantly impact the lifespan of both the needle and the sewing machine, as well as reduce the likelihood of needle breakage, hence preventing potentially costly machine repairs.

Next comes the most critical part stitching. Hand stitching is primarily done using a method known as the saddle stitch, a technique that employs two needles and a single length of thread. This method is favored for its strength and durability, ensuring that the seams can withstand wear and tear over time. The process involves creating holes with an awl, allowing for precise and evenly spaced stitches, which contribute to the item’s overall aesthetic.

2. Heat Sealing Machines These machines utilize heat to melt and bond the edges of thermoplastic bags. The process is swift and ensures a tight seal, making it ideal for packaging food items, chemicals, and other products that require an airtight closure. Modern heat sealing machines can handle various bag sizes and have advanced features like adjustable temperature settings and automatic feeder systems.

stainless braided oil linePump suction hoses are flexible tubing systems that connect the pump's inlet to the liquid supply. These hoses are typically made from rubber, PVC, or other high-strength synthetic materials that can withstand both negative pressure and the corrosive properties of various fluids. The design of suction hoses often includes features such as reinforcement layers to prevent collapsing under vacuum pressure and various fittings to connect to pumps and other equipment securely.

Brake hoses are made of durable materials designed to withstand high pressure and harsh conditions. However, they can be susceptible to wear and tear from exposure to heat, chemicals, and environmental elements. Signs that your brake hoses may need replacement include visible cracks, bulges, or leaks. Ignoring these warning signs can lead to brake failure, which is why timely replacement is crucial for your safety.

At their core, hydraulic hoses are pipes or tubes designed to carry hydraulic fluid under pressure. These hoses are made from layers of flexible materials, often reinforced with textiles or steel braids, to ensure they can handle extreme pressure and physical stresses. The design allows them to bend and flex, providing the versatility needed for dynamic machinery.

Brake hoses are flexible tubes that carry brake fluid from the master cylinder to the brake calipers. When a driver presses the brake pedal, hydraulic pressure is created in the master cylinder, pushing the brake fluid through the hoses to activate the brakes at each wheel. This process is crucial for effective stopping power, as it allows the driver to control the vehicle's speed and direction.
